4. Elsa Speak
Elsa Speak is a language learning app that uses AI technology to assist you in learning how to improve your pronunciation, vocabulary and grammar. It was launched in the year 2019, and its design team comprises language experts, tech specialists and data scientists.
The app uses technology for speech recognition that is powered by deep learning algorithms to give you real-time feedback and assist you in learning English. It provides bite-sized lessons as well as short tests, and trackers to maximize the speed of your learning.
ELSA Speak’s pronunciation lessons offer footage of speakers from the native language who demonstrate the correct shape of their mouth and tongue position for saying various sounds correctly. After practicing common words using those sounds, you’ll be able to receive instant feedback on your pronunciation.
These lessons are ideal for those who are beginners or intermediates seeking to sharpen their English speaking abilities. Additionally, there’s a thriving community of learners and you can even book private tutors one-on-one to improve your learning.
The app also comes with a pronunciation test that provides guidelines and a comprehensive review of the test’s results. The suggestions are color coded by color, with green marking good pronunciation, yellow highlighting okay-ish, and red problematic.
